Lochinvar Marine Harvest
Its design is pattern GKGKBBBKGKGKGKGKGKBBBKGK — the page of every tartan sharing this colour sequence.
The Lochinvar Marine Harvest tartan is recorded as a single sett.
| Sett | ΔTartan | Thread count | Threads | Date |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Lochinvar Marine Harvest | K/4 G16 K14 DB16 DP4 DB16 K14 G4 K4 G4 K4 G20 K4 G4 K4 G4 K14 DB16 DP4 DB16 K14 G16 K4 G/4 | 440 | 1989 | |
